Latest Patents

One of Ochi's latest patents is a camera holding device for an automatic analysis apparatus. This invention aims to provide a solution for easily adjusting the tip positions of pipetting nozzles with different lengths, utilizing a single-focus camera. The device includes an expansion/contraction part that adjusts vertically with respect to the pipetting arm, an arm-side fixing part that secures one end of the expansion/contraction part to the arm, and a camera-side fixing part that attaches the camera to the other end. Another notable patent is an imaging device designed to detect deviation amounts in two directions between the tip of a nozzle and a target stop position from a single image. This imaging device is integrated into a pipetting device and features a camera along with a pair of mirrors arranged to optimize the imaging process.
